PSLV also carries students' satellite to space
Monday, 1 January 2024
For the students and staff of K J Somaiya Institute of Technology in Mumbai, the New Year's day will mark the beginning of their journey towards the stars. The reason: when the four-stage PSLV lifted off at Sriharikota at 9.10 am, the rocket's fourth stage called POEM (PSLV Orbital Experimental Module) had a satellite designed and developed by students and faculty of the institute. Named 'Somaiya BeliefSat-0', it is the second satellite to fly from Mumbai, the first one being Pratham of IIT-B which was launched on September 16, 2016.
